Abstract

The example embodiment(s) relates to a method for monitoring the position of a jockey wheel of a trailer, including sensing a region lying behind a motor vehicle by means of a camera, processing the sensed image data by means of an evaluation unit and identifying the jockey wheel, and determining the position of the jockey wheel, comparing the sensed position of the jockey wheel with a secured position of the jockey wheel, and outputting a warning signal if the sensed position of the jockey wheel deviates from the secured position. The example embodiment(s) further relates to a camera system and to a motor vehicle including a camera system according to the example embodiment(s).

DETAILED DESCRIPTION

[0032] FIG. 1 shows a schematic representation of a flow chart of a method according to the example embodiment(s) for monitoring the position of a jockey wheel 18 of a trailer 16 in a configuration. In a first step S1, a region lying behind a motor vehicle 12 is sensed by means of a camera 14. In a second step S2, the sensed image data of the camera 14 are analyzed by means of an evaluation unit 22. The jockey wheel 18 is identified and the position of the jockey wheel 18 is determined. In order to identify the jockey wheel 18, known object identification methods may be enlisted. In a third step S3, the sensed position of the jockey wheel 18 is compared with a secured position of the jockey wheel 18. The secured position may be a distance between the jockey wheel 18 in a secured position, in particular in a nominal position, and the roadway 30. The distance is stored in a storage unit 28. In a fourth step S4, a warning signal is output if the sensed position of the jockey wheel 18 deviates from the secured position. The warning signal is only output if the distance of the sensed jockey wheel 18 from the roadway 30 is smaller than the nominal distance and deviates from the secured distance by a threshold.
